Mnkyface - I had noticed the muddle Leonard got into with the recaps in 'Closing Time' and I giggle each time I watch it, it was all part of the fun on the night, he didn't seem too worried whereas in the past he would have been stressed by it. Something else I noticed was that he knelt for us at the end of the song, and he stayed down for some time. I don't know if he has done that much before, I took it to mean he was pleased we had all stayed with him through the monsoon. He has knelt for his lovers in the past in his songs, I think we were all his lovers that night and I like to think that was what he was expressing. ;-)

On 'Live in London' he made a bit of a booboo in Bird on a Wire when he started with 'I thought a liar..' (quickly recovered, singing) 'I thought a lover had to be some kind of liar too'. Seamless.
